Responsibilities

Histological Operations:

  • Gross tissue specimens, accession into computer system, and process using appropriate fixation, dehydration, and clearing techniques
  • Embed tissue specimens in paraffin blocks, cut sections using rotary microtomes (3-5 microns), and mount on glass slides
  • Perform routine H&E staining, execute special stains per pathologist requests, and coverslip slides for microscopic examination
  • Assist pathologists with frozen section procedures, prepare and cut frozen sections using cryostat equipment

Autopsy Support:

  • Serve as backup morgue assistant providing basic assistance during autopsy procedures including body identification, setup, examination support, closure, and cleanup

Quality Assurance and Equipment:

  • Maintain specimen integrity, control processing conditions for optimal tissue preservation and staining quality
  • Operate and maintain histological processing equipment, perform routine maintenance and calibration, troubleshoot issues
  • Participate in quality control programs, document procedures, and follow established protocols for specimen handling

Patient Safety and Administrative:

  • Positively identify specimens, safeguard patient information, follow safety protocols and infection control measures
  • Participate in monthly Laboratory Quality Improvement and Staff meetings (24 hours annually total)
  • Complete mandatory VA training and maintain continuing education requirements

Qualifications

Education and Certification:

  • Bachelor's degree in health sciences/allied sciences appropriate to histopathology OR Bachelor's with 30+ semester hours of biology/chemistry OR 2 years graduate education in related field
  • Current Histotechnologist (HTL) certification from ASCP Board of Certification
  • US Citizenship for Public Trust government security clearance

Experience and Skills:

  • Minimum 3 years recent histology and cytology experience including fixation, embedding, microtomy, processing, and staining
  • Proficiency in tissue processing techniques, histological stains, microtomy, and laboratory information systems
  • Excellent manual dexterity, attention to detail, organizational skills, and ability to work independently
  • Physical ability to stand for extended periods and work with precision instruments
